header za2 {background: lime;}
header za2 span.pf-r {border-color: red;}

header zb1 {background: lime;}
header zb1 span.pf-r {border-color: red;}

/*doli*/
#c127 {
  margin-top: 0rem;
  min-width: 640px;  
  max-width: 1280px;
  border-top: 0rem dashed red; 
    display: flex;          /* aktiviert Flexbox */
    height: 90vh;          /* volle Höhe des Viewports */
    overflow-x: scroll;                                              
           }

/* linkes Fenster */
.i1  {
    flex: 3;                /* nimmt gleich viel Platz wie rechts */
    min-width: 0;           /* verhindert Überlauf durch Scrollbalken */
    overflow: none;         /* Scrollen nur innerhalb dieses Fensters */
    background: #e0f7fa;    /* hellblau zur Orientierung */
    padding: 5px;
    #border: .25rem solid lime;
   
  }

  /* rechtes Fenster */
.i2  {
    flex: 13;                /* ebenfalls gleich breit */
    min-width: 0;           /* wichtig für saubere Breitenberechnung */
    overflow: none;         /* Scrollen nur innerhalb dieses Fensters */
    background: #f1f8e9;    /* hellgrün zur Orientierung */
    padding: 10px;
    #border: .25rem solid yellow;;
  }


  .i1 iframe, .i2 iframe {
  width: 100%;
  height: 100%;
  border: none;
}



